Gorm问题帮助

时间:2011-07-15 12:24:44

标签: grails gorm

我有两个班级

class Facebook {
   String fid
   String name
   User user
   static constraints = {
       user(nullable:false)
   }
}

class User {
   Facebook facebook
   String fullname
}

我创建一个Facebook对象,然后创建一个User对象,当我尝试保存用户时,它不会 请允许我 。错误就像

Trying to marshall a null id [id] for alias [User]

请帮忙

1 个答案:

答案 0 :(得分:2)

您应该检查如何使用此链接设置与Grails GORM的一对一映射:

http://grails.org/doc/latest/guide/5.%20Object%20Relational%20Mapping%20(GORM).html#5.2.1.1 Many-to-one and one-to-one

Face和Nose有一个类似于User / Facebook的例子。